ORC Research has shared the results of its survey conducted using the CATI (Computer Assisted Telephone Interviewing) method.
In the study, which was carried out between August 10-12 with 2,260 participants in 26 provinces, citizens were asked the question, "Do you think there should be an early election?"
While 47.5 percent of participants answered 'yes', the rate of those who said 'no' was 39.5 percent. 13 percent responded with 'no opinion'.
The rate of those wanting an early election was 43 percent between May 5-11, 45.9 percent between June 10-14, and 46.3 percent last month.
